How to Capture a Freeze Screen on Windows

On Windows, you can freeze the screen and capture a still image using built-in tools without extra software.

The Game Bar is ideal for gamers, while the standard keyboard shortcuts work across most apps and desktop environments.

By default, the PrtScn key copies the entire screen to the clipboard, letting you paste directly into image editors or documentation.

How to Capture a Freeze Screen on Mobile

Mobile devices use a combination of hardware buttons and software menus to freeze and capture the screen with high fidelity.

On iOS, the Share Sheet gives you instant access to a still image of the current frame without opening extra apps.

On Android, holding the power and volume down buttons captures the screen and saves it to your gallery automatically.

Optimizing Your Workflow with Freeze Screen Methods

  • Assign a single, consistent shortcut or button combo for freezes to reduce hesitation and mistakes.
  • Use lossless formats like PNG when you need pixel accuracy, and compressed formats like JPEG for faster sharing.
  • Name each freeze with timestamps or project codes so you can trace it back to the original session easily.
  • Batch rename and organize captures in folders by date, tool, or purpose to keep your workspace efficient.
  • Review captured frames regularly to identify recurring patterns, bugs, or opportunities for improvement.

Does using the Print Screen key affect game performance or frame rate?

No, pressing the Print Screen key causes a brief frame capture that usually does not impact performance, while in-game capture tools may add slight overhead.

Can I capture a freeze screen on a laptop without a dedicated Print Screen key?

Yes, you can use the Function key combined with the camera icon or a software shortcut, and many laptops map this function to alternative keys.

Will taking a freeze screen drain the battery faster on a mobile device?

A single capture has a negligible impact on battery life, but frequent screenshots may add up over long sessions on older devices.

Can I capture audio along with a freeze screen on video calls?

Standard freeze screen actions only capture the current video frame, so you need separate audio recording tools if you want to save the sound that accompanies the frame.
